变量 基础 方法java

掌握Java面向对象OOP篇(一)

掌握面向对象OOP篇(一) 边学边记 -- OOP(Object Orientated Programing) 1. 为什么要引入面向对象? 原因:封装、继承、多态 举个例子理解面向对象代码的好处: 比如:我们有一个实际问题,假设现在一个宠物店有两只小狗, 第一只叫做小白,年龄2岁,白色;第二只叫做 ......
对象 Java OOP

微信小程序--给手机号中间的号码用*代替的方法

public.wxs // 处理手机号中间四位不显示 function filterPhone(val) {var reg = getRegExp('^(\d{3})\d{4}(\d+)'); return val.replace(reg, '$1****$2'); } module.exports ......
手机号 号码 程序 方法 手机

什么是Java中的process_reaper线程?

随着时间的推移,我在应用程序中获得了成百上千个这样的process_reaper线程。有人知道这些可能是什么吗?它们似乎是在我的Runtime.exec()中使用的,但是我在finally语句中销毁了我的进程,但它们仍然会出现 屏幕截图:http://www.dropmocks.com/mBxM5 ......
线程 process_reaper process reaper Java

JAVA分批处理数据简单示例

功能描述 在处理业务时,经常遇到需要分批次处理数据的场景,例如有105条数据,每次推送20条,分批次推送 最后不足20条数据时,一次性推送全部剩余数据 DEMO示例 package shiguang.test; import java.util.ArrayList; import java.util ......
示例 数据 JAVA

C++U3-第1课-基础排序(一)

学习目标 排序的概念 本阶段会学习的排序有 冒泡排序概念 第一轮比较,与交换 例题1:一趟交换 例题2:多躺比较,冒泡排序 【题意分析】 进行n-1趟冒泡排序的过程,每一次输出当前一趟冒泡排序完的结果 【思路分析】 定义一个n,输入当前的n和储存n个数的数组 for循环的方式进行n(n-1)趟排序 ......
基础 U3

Java 学生管理系统

需求: ​ 采取控制台的方式去书写学生管理系统。 分析: 初始菜单: " 欢迎来到学生管理系统 " "1:添加学生" "2:删除学生" "3:修改学生" "4:查询学生" "5:退出" "请输入您的选择:" 学生类: ​ 属性:id、姓名、年龄、家庭住址 添加功能: ​ 键盘录入每一个学生信息并添加 ......
管理系统 学生 系统 Java

uniapp vue可以通过mixins混入代码,可以通过下面方法混入template

vue全局混入template方法:在根目录vue.config.js(没有就新增)里添加一下代码 //红色部分是混入的自定义vue组件module.exports = { chainWebpack: config => { config.module.rule('vue').use('vue-lo ......
可以通过 template 代码 方法 uniapp

恢复数据的方法

1.从备份的数据库中恢复 【优点】:能完整恢复到恢复时间点的数据,适合大批量数据的恢复 【不足】: 数据恢复繁锁,所需要时间长 从备份数据库解压,导入数据,再恢复相应的数据表需要比较长的时间。数据库越大,所需的时间越长。 恢复时间点后的数据丢失,需要从别的方法恢复 2.备份的临时数据 【优点】:可实 ......
方法 数据

EXCEL中逆向查找的十种方法

Excel 逆向查找,Excel 逆向查找方法,Excel MATCH函数,Excel INDEX函数,Excel LOOKUP函数,Excel OFFSET函数,Excel VBA编程,Excel 条件格式化,Excel 高级筛选,Excel 透视表 ......
方法 EXCEL

Java -day3

四 方法 4.4命令行传递参数 main方法也可以传递参数 通过cmd 命令提示符运行 先编译 注意包的位置(回退) public class Demo03 { public static void main(String[] args) { for (int i = 0; i < args.len ......
Java day3 day

SQL執行更新或刪除時,避免誤操作方法

1.使用數據表別名 儘量使用數據表別名,先對要操作的數據進行查詢,確保數據準確無誤。 SELECT * --DELETE w --updatge w set iw_RptId='231110TB201-010' FROM IPQAInsWo w WHERE iw_RptId='231110TB201 ......
方法 SQL

java数值前面补零

Java数值前面补零在Java编程中,有时候我们需要对数字进行格式化,例如在输出时希望数字的前面补零。这在一些情况下是很有用的,比如显示日期、时间、序列号等。在本文中,我们将介绍几种方法来实现Java数值前面补零的操作,并提供相应的代码示例。 使用String类的format方法Java中的Stri ......
数值 java

半导体基础SECS协议(SECS - II)

SECS - II协议定义了使用如SECS-I、HSMS等传输协议在设备和主机之间交换的消息的形式和含义,是SECS四项基础协议中的核心。 往下,HSMS、SECS-I等物理协议为其服务,通过某种传输介质,在设备间传输SECS-II消息(此时SECS-II消息存储在物理层协议消息结构的DATA部分中 ......
SECS 半导体 基础

java pdf数字签证(图片),根据关键字定位签证位置

网上找了很多,最后还是结合了一下才能用。 用到的主要jar包:itextpdf-5.5.13.jar,bcprov-jdk15on-1.49.jar,bcpkix-jdk15on-1.50.jar main测试: import java.io.FileInputStream;import java. ......
签证 关键字 位置 关键 数字

Lua的基础与运用

Lua编辑器 Lua的基础 Lua的教学网址 Lua的编辑器 编辑器调试 点击选项——调试参数配置,在脚本工作目录里选择位置,之后lua脚本都需要在该目录里,之后下面两个都打钩,点击确定。 窗口界面可以建立垂直布局 Lua的基础 注释 单行注释: --注释内容 多行注释: --[[多行 注释 内容] ......
基础 Lua

迭代器模式--Java实现

具体代码 //Student.java package org.example.test016; public class Student { public String getId() { return id; } public void setId(String id) { this.id = ......
模式 Java

命令模式--Java实现

相关类图 具体代码 //Invoker.java package org.example.test015; public class Invoker { public void setCommand(Command command) { this.command = command; } priva ......
命令 模式 Java

[实验任务一]:JAVA和C++常见数据结构迭代器的使用

信1305班共44名同学,每名同学都有姓名,学号和年龄等属性,分别使用JAVA内置迭代器和C++中标准模板库(STL)实现对同学信息的遍历,要求按照学号从小到大和从大到小两种次序输出学生信息。 实验要求: 1. 搜集并掌握JAVA和C++中常见的数据结构和迭代器的使用方法,例如,vector, li ......
数据结构 常见 任务 结构 数据

Java开发者的Python快速进修指南:函数进阶

在这篇文章中,我们介绍了函数的两种不常用的特殊用法:匿名函数和装饰器函数。匿名函数是一种没有名称的函数,通常用于定义简单的功能。我们可以使用lambda关键字来创建匿名函数,并在需要时直接调用它们。装饰器函数是一种特殊的函数,可以接受一个函数作为参数,并返回一个新的函数。装饰器函数通常用于在不改变原... ......
开发者 函数 指南 Python Java

设置 IntelliJ IDEA 的默认字符集的方法

设置 IntelliJ IDEA 的默认字符集的方法 1、在顶部菜单栏找到“帮助(Help)”项(通常是最后一项),点击它并在弹出的二级菜单中选择“编辑定制虚拟机选项(Edit Custom VM Options...)”项。 2、在默认追加如下配置: -Dfile.encoding=UTF-8 3 ......
字符集 字符 IntelliJ 方法 IDEA

数据结构和迭代器的使用方法

Java 数据结构和迭代器使用方法 1. ArrayList (动态数组) 创建 ArrayList: ArrayList<String> list = new ArrayList<>(); 添加元素: list.add("Element1"); list.add("Element2"); 访问元素 ......

Java设计模式之命令模式

命令模式(Command Pattern)是一种行为型设计模式,又叫动作模式或事务模式。它将请求(命令)封装成对象,使得可以用不同的请求对客户端进行参数化,具体的请求可以在运行时更改、排队或记录,它讲发出者和接收者解耦(顺序:发出者-->命令-->接收者)本质:封装请求 抽象命令(Command): ......
模式 设计模式 命令 Java

Java设计模式之迭代器模式

迭代器模式是一种行为型设计模式,它提供了一种统一的方式来访问集合对象中的元素,而不是暴露集合内部的表示方式。简单地说,就是将遍历集合的责任封装到一个单独的对象中,我们可以按照特定的方式访问集合中的元素。 抽象迭代器(Iterator):定义了遍历聚合对象所需的方法,包括hashNext()和next ......
模式 设计模式 Java

基础课-Java3

引用类型: 数组类型 管理相同类型的多个数据,数组中的数据可称为元素 1.数组的定义 数组类型 [ ] 数组名 (变量名) 具体值的情况下:数组类型 [ ] 数组名 = {值,值,...,值}; 2. 创建数组 本质上就是赋值数组名 = new 数据类型 [长度] (长度就是数据的个数) 数组是引用 ......
基础课 基础 Java3 Java

Python学习之十四_Python连接各种数据库的方法(DM,oscar,Oracle,SQLSERVER,MYSQL,PG,Kingbase

Python学习之十四_Python连接各种数据库的方法(DM,oscar,Oracle,SQLSERVER,MYSQL,PG,Kingbase) 前言 想着能够使用多种数据库进行一些操作. 所以本文档讲解对多种数据库的连接方式进行一下总结. 备查 1. Oracle数据库 方式1: jaydebe ......
Python SQLSERVER Kingbase 数据库 方法

Python 按规则解析并替换字符串中的变量及函数

按规则解析并替换字符串中的变量及函数 需求 1、按照一定规则解析字符串中的函数、变量表达式,并替换这些表达式。这些函数表达式可能包含其它函数表达式,即支持函数嵌套 2、函数表达式格式:${ __函数名称() }、${__函数名称( 函数参数 )} 3、变量表达式格式:${ varName } 注意: ......
字符串 变量 函数 字符 规则

JAVA函数,形参默认值,可选形参实现

就结论来说不能实现以下这张默认参数设置的语法 (看到有帖子说能做,但我怀疑是胡编乱造的) 1 public void printMessage(String message = "Hello, World!") 2 { 3 4 } 下面来列举下几个实现方法 1.函数重载 1 public void ......
函数 JAVA

Netty-基础篇(3)

UNIX网络编程I/O模型 1.阻塞I/O模型(BIO,同步阻塞I/O) 2.非阻塞I/O模型(NIO,非阻塞I/O) 3.I/O复用模型 4.信号驱动I/O模型 5.异步I/O(AIO,事件驱动I/O) 传输 1.OIO-阻塞传输 2.NIO-异步传输 3.Local-JVM内部的异步通信 4.E ......
基础 Netty

脱贫户收入录入脚本程序使用方法

一、下载地址 链接:https://pan.baidu.com/s/1cOlNdIjYpePxndtzUD2bFw 提取码:pr9n 二、配置运行环境 (1)下载谷歌浏览器,查看浏览器版本(下一个低版本的Chrome) 打开chrome 在网页地址栏中输入 “chrome://version/”来查 ......
贫户 使用方法 脚本 收入 程序

2023-2024-1 20231413 《计算机基础与程序设计》第八周学习总结

2023-2024-1 20231413 《计算机基础与程序设计》第八周学习总结 1. 作业信息 班级:2023-2024-1-计算机基础与程序设计 作业要求:2023-2024-1 《计算机基础与程序设计》教学进程 目标:自学教材: 计算机科学概论第9章并完成云班课测试 《C语言程序设计》第7章并 ......